### v3.2.0 — Pagination defaults changed

The Orchent public REST API now defaults to cursor-based pagination on all list endpoints. The previous offset mode remains available via an explicit query parameter, but the default page size, maximum page size, and cursor expiry have all changed. Clients relying on implicit values must be re-verified before release. The new effective defaults are as follows.

settings of tagef-bawif:
DRUIX_HOST=druix.zemvarlabs.internal
DRUIX_PORT=8000

## Environments: Build Agent Clock Skew

The Orvane CI fleet spans two regions, and we have repeatedly observed skew of several seconds between agents in the Bramwick pool and the primary pool. This invalidates timestamp-based cache keys and caused two phantom rebuilds last quarter. Maintainers should verify sync status before widening the tolerance window. Each agent applies the following time-sync configuration on enrollment.

settings of yaguf-fajof:
[druvan]
host = druvan.plorvatech.example
user = druvan_svc
database = druvan_prod

## Session Handling: Queue Migration Notes

With the retirement of our homegrown job queue (Skillet), session expiry sweeps now run through Cadence Relay. Sessions are no longer pinned to a worker; any Relay consumer may process expiry events, so do not assume ordering. Sticky-session cleanup hooks were ported as-is from Skillet's cron shim. Relay consumers authenticate to the session store with the token below.

session JWT of yawep-yawep = eyJhbGciOiJIUzI1NiIsInR5cCI6IkpXVCJ9.eyJzdWIiOiI3pWF3_In0.aXYsHiog